Sans Contrasted Hibe 12 is a very bold, wide, very high cont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

A heavy, display-oriented sans with broad proportions and pronounced internal cut-ins that create a strong light–dark rhythm. Strokes are largely monolinear in impression but punctuated by sharp, vertical notches and narrow internal channels that heighten contrast and add a mechanical, cut-out feel. Curved letters (C, G, O, Q, S) keep smooth outer bowls, while many verticals and joins show squared terminals and hard corners, producing a robust, engineered texture. The lowercase follows the same geometry with compact counters, a single-storey a, and a strong, rectangular footprint across many forms; numerals are similarly bold with distinctive internal apertures.

Best used at display sizes where the internal cut-ins and compact counters remain clear. It fits posters, sports or event titling, bold branding lockups, packaging fronts, and high-impact signage where a strong, engineered presence is desired.

The overall tone is confident and attention-grabbing, with a retro-industrial flavor that feels suited to bold statements and headline-driven layouts. The notched detailing adds a sporty, stencil-adjacent edge, giving the face a punchy, graphic character rather than a neutral text voice.

The design appears intended to deliver maximum visual impact through massed strokes and a repeatable notched motif, creating a recognizable industrial/sport display voice while remaining broadly sans in structure.

Spacing and sidebearings appear tuned for dense, impactful setting, and the narrow interior openings can close up quickly at smaller sizes. The distinctive internal cut-ins read as a consistent motif across rounds and stems, giving the font a recognizable signature in words and at large scale.
